求asp.net控制下拉菜单的代码 40

比如说,我现在有两个下拉菜单,在第一个菜单选择了“手机”,第二个菜单出现相应的选项,比如“小米”“诺基亚”而不会出现“华硕”就是下拉列表的二级联动... 比如说,我现在有两个下拉菜单,在第一个菜单选择了“手机”,第二个菜单出现相应的选项,比如“小米”“诺基亚”而不会出现“华硕”
就是下拉列表的二级联动
展开
 我来答
漫步人生ahri
2014-12-22 · TA获得超过171个赞
知道小有建树答主
回答量:221
采纳率:0%
帮助的人:184万
展开全部

将第一个下拉菜单绑定SelectedIndexChanged事件

然后把它的AutoPostBack属性置为真...


然后在SelectedIndexChanged(就是当他选择发生改变的时候) 编写事件

 protected void DropDownList1_SelectedIndexChanged(object sender, EventArgs e)
        {
            string vlaue = this.DropDownList1.SelectedValue;//获得当前选中的值
            //然后你根据这个值,查询数据库,或者读取什么东西,就是要确定第二个下拉菜单的值
            //查出来的值通过foreach存到DropDownList2里面,用下面的方法绑定
            //DropDownList2.Items.Add(new ListItem("文本","值"));

        }
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式